    Stand-alone building just off 290 seems to be primarily a watering hole…read more General Gau's Wings: Very small wings, practically pigeon-sized, but for $15 you get 10 connected drum-flat pairs, so that's 20 pieces at 75 cents each, which I consider a bargain. Fully coated in a sauce darker than your typical General, and with a bit of an oyster saucy feel. Good mix of sweet and spicy. Crisp exterior; fairly moist interior (tough to accomplish on such small wings, but they did). But most importantly, these wings had so much flavor under the sauce that they must've been marinated. I'm very eager to try their regular wings now. Near-elite. Sweet and Sour Chicken (on combo): Pretty standard fare. Crispness was okay, no puffiness, typical meat-to-batter ratio. Sauce a bit on the blush side of bright red, no gumminess, and sour mixed in with the sweet. Cherries and pineapples. A little above average. Pork Fried Rice (on the combo): Invitingly dark of color, but not as much on flavor. A bit sticky. Not dry, but close. Pork seemed to be the only inclusion (not an issue; just pointing it out for those who aren't into egg, onion, or bean sprouts). Average. Egg Roll (added to the combo for $1): Standard issue, old school design with mostly celery and some faintly colored pork specks. Crisp outside, kinda dry inside. A bit below average, but serviceable. While not a home run of a visit, enough good signs to warrant a return, especially to try wings and to see if the pork fried rice fares better on a night visit (when I can also partake in a mai tai).

    First visit in about 10 years. When I worked in Worcester back then, it was in my rotation and they…read moredid a respectable take on old school Chinese, even though it was unglamorous and paled in comparison to Ho Toy Luau (R.I.P.). They've sealed off most of their tables, leaving only two for dine-in, but it's mostly takeout anyway. Beef Teriyaki: Small order yielded three sticks, each with very thin, slightly charred beef. Overly strong salty soy flavor and a texture that summons the adage that there's a very fine line between moist and slimy. But at least not dry and not tough. Sweet and Sour Chicken (on a combo): Thin fingers, less-than-crisp corndog style batter, and low meat-to-batter ratio. Small cup of thin red sweet sauce (no sour) on the side. No fruit. Egg Roll (on the combo): Hot and crisp, but cabbage style with minimal pork and minimal flavor. Pork Fried Rice (on the combo): Nice color, but Rice-a Roni flavor and dry, crunchy texture. Fried rice isn't supposed to be crunchy. Probably a reheat. Well, Hong Kong Island? See you in another 10 years. Maybe.
